Курс Бази даних з нуля

  • Online
  • Для початківців
  • SQL / DBA
Навчальний центр: Sigma Software University
Формат:Курс
Мова викладання:Ukrainian
Тривалість навчання:10 занять
Початок курсу:17.06.2025
Вартість навчання:8 125 UAH за курс

Курс охоплює основи проєктування, нормалізації та денормалізації даних, роботу з даними (створення виборок, вставка даних, їх оновлення та видалення), агрегації та з'єднання, створення індексів, використання аналітичних функцій та сучасних підходів у роботі з даними, таких як машинне навчання, Generative AI та інтеграція з GPT. Ти ознайомишся з основними типами баз даних (локальні, серверні, хмарні), навчишся створювати ER-діаграми та виконувати запити на вибірку, об'єднання та зміну даних.

Програма курсу

Теми:

  • Вступ до баз даних
  • Типи баз даних (локальні, серверні, хмарні), моделювання даних, ER-діаграми, інструменти для ERD
    • Практичне завдання: нормалізація та встановлення необхідного програмного забезпечення
  • Використання оператора Select для виборки даних
    • Обмеження виводу великої кількості даних
    • Виборка унікальних значень
    • Виборка даних, відповідно до критеріїв (числові значення, діапазон числових значень, перелік числових значень, текстові значення, значення дата/час)
    • Розраховані поля
    • Агреговані значення, групування даних
    • Практичне завдання: вибірка та групування даних, а також моделювання даних
  • Об'єднання таблиць (Joins)
    • Первинні та зовнішні ключі (PK, FK)
    • Індекси
    • Обчислювані поля
    • Створення подань (views)
  • Індексовані та матеріалізовані подання, використання віконних функцій
    • Практичне завдання: об'єднання таблиць (JOINs) та моделювання даних
  • Використання підзапитів, Union, Except, Загальні табличні вирази (CTE)
  • Операції з таблицями
    • Розберемо операції CREATE TABLE, INSERT, VALUES, SELECT INTO, UPDATE, DELETE, MERGE
    • Практичне завдання: використання підзапитів, CTE та моделювання даних
  • CREATE/ALTER/DROP TABLE/ INDEX, Змінні таблиці, Тимчасові таблиці
  • Огляд IOT, Нереляційних БД (NRDBMS), Великих даних (Big Data) та хмарних технологій
    • Практичне завдання: робота з рядками та датами, моделювання даних
  • Сучасні підходи у роботі з базами даних
    • Машинне навчання (ML)
    • Штучний інтелект (AI)
    • Великі мовні моделі (LLM)
    • Генеративний AI
    • Створення промптів для GPT
    • Використання GPT у розробці баз даних

Що ти отримаєш по завершенню курсу

  • Навички роботи з SQL-запитами та моделюванням даних
  • Практичний досвід використання GPT для автоматизації запитів
  • Вміння працювати з реляційними базами даних
  • Досвід створення запитів, використання індексів
  • Розуміння сучасних трендів: великі дані, машинне навчання, AI та їхній вплив на бази даних

Що потрібно для навчання

  • Бажання вчитися - курс розроблений для новачків, тому спеціальні знання не обов'язкові
  • Вільний час для практики - окрім занять, тобі знадобиться час для виконання домашніх завдань (приблизно 2 години на кожне з 5 завдань)
  • Готовність до нових підходів - ми будемо працювати не лише з класичними методами, але й з сучасними рішеннями, як-от GPT та машинне навчання

Особливості курсу

  • Навчання з нуля - курс не вимагає попередніх знань, тому ідеально підходить для тих, хто тільки починає свій шлях у сфері роботи з даними
  • Поєднання теорії та практики - після теоретичних блоків учасники виконують практичні завдання, що дозволяє краще закріпити знання
  • Системний підхід - крок за кроком ти опануєш структуру баз даних, їхнє моделювання, типи, об'єднання, запити, підзапити, створення таблиць та багато іншого
  • Актуальні теми - окрім класичних SQL-запитів, ми торкаємося сучасних тем, таких як індекси, аналітичні функції, штучний інтелект і GPT у роботі з базами даних
  • Сертифікат про проходження курсу
  • Допомога ментора

Викладачі курсу

Максим Івашура - Senior Database / Data Warehouse Engineer

Категорії курсу

Читайте нас в Telegram, щоб не пропустити анонси нових курсів.

Схожі курси

Навчальний центр
SkillsUp
Формат
Online
Початок навчання
Будь-який момент
Тривалість
4 тижнів
Рівень
Для початківців
Мова навчання
Ukrainian
Вартість
4 680 UAH за курс
Навчальний центр
DataBI
Формат
Online
Початок навчання
Будь-який момент
Тривалість
3 місяців
Рівень
Для досвідчених
Мова навчання
Russian
Вартість
140 USD за курс
Навчальний центр
Networking Technologies
Формат
Online
Початок навчання
20.07.2026
Тривалість
5 днів
Рівень
Для досвідчених
Мова навчання
Ukrainian
Вартість
уточнюйте
Навчальний центр
QALight
Формат
Online
Початок навчання
20.07.2026
Тривалість
32 годин
Рівень
Для початківців
Мова навчання
Ukrainian
Вартість
4 910 UAH за курс